Fig. 3: Refractive Index sensing.
From: A Fabry-Pérot cavity coupled surface plasmon photodiode for electrical biomolecular sensing

a, b Photocurrent as a function of angle in solutions of different glycerol concentration [0%, 10%, 20%, 30%, 40%, 50%] with RI = 1.333, 1.346, 1.359, 1.371, 1.384, 1.397 for silicon sample a and TiO2 sample b. c Photocurrent as a function of time for changing glycerol concentration at the fixed angles indicated by the dashed lines in a, b for Si (blue) and TiO2 (orange). The TiO2 data is multiplied by a factor of 10 for clarity. The upper panel (green) indicates the corresponding glycerol concentration (left axis) and RI (right axis) of the solution.
